Why Live in Parkside

Parkside, a neighborhood in Buffalo, features spacious homes with diverse architectural styles, including Colonial Revivals, American Foursquares, and Queen Anne-inspired designs. Many residences boast three or more bedrooms and ample backyard space, with natural woodwork that reflects their century-old heritage. Delaware Park, designed by Frederick Law Olmsted, borders the neighborhood and includes sports fields, pickleball courts, an 18-hole golf course, and shaded trails. The park also houses The Buffalo Zoo, a notable attraction with over 1,400 animal exhibits. Dining options in Parkside include JAM café and Lloyd Taco Factory, while daily necessities are available at the nearby Delaware Consumer Square Target. The neighborhood hosts annual events like The Chicken Wing Festival and Dyngus Day, drawing large crowds for food, music, and cultural celebrations. Parkside is highly walkable, with easy access to the Scajaquada Expressway, Main Street, and larger highways like Interstate 190. The Buffalo Niagara International Airport is 8 miles away, and the Erie County Medical Center Health Campus is less than 3 miles from the community. Educational institutions in Parkside include the highly rated PS 064 Frederick Law Olmsted, Elmwood Franklin School, and Nichols School, providing quality options for families.
